TT 09-28-2004 11:20 AM

Quote:

Originally Posted by godspeed06
why is white the worst for photoshopping?

Well, first of all, on a white car in most cases many lines are like flattened, they disappear when it's white and then well, when you paint a white car in PS usually you end up with a red/blue/green whatever car on wich you miss those details that were missing because of the base color ;)

coombsie66 09-28-2004 12:42 PM

Well, to get you noticed obviously as bright a colour as possible is gunna do the trick, but if your looking for sponsorship then i'd stay clear of the gulf colour scheme, as it may clash with sponsors logo's and it leaves less panel space for big stickers. A white car would be best for making simple graphics stand out, and easy to paint if you stuff it, or to touch up slight stone chips or tyre donughts!
What series is it your racing in?
Also if you have any ideas of prospective sponsers, then you should probably go for a colour that suits their graphics/logos. :)
